1-x/1+x=2x+1/-2x+5 find x

Answers

Answer:

x = [tex]\frac{2}{5}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

[tex]\frac{1-x}{1+x}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{2x+1}{-2x+5}[/tex] ( cross- multiply )

(2x + 1)(1 + x) = (1 - x)(- 2x + 5) ← expand parenthesis on both sides using FOIL

2x + 2x² + 1 + x = - 2x + 5 + 2x² - 5x , simplify

2x² + 3x + 1 = 2x² - 7x + 5 ( subtract 2x² from both sides )

3x + 1 = - 7x + 5 ( add 7x to both sides )

10x + 1 = 5 ( subtract 1 from both sides )

10x = 4 ( divide both sides by 10 )

x = [tex]\frac{4}{10}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{2}{5}[/tex]

A salesperson earns $8 per hour plus 6% commission on her sales. In a week when she worked 40 hours, her total earning were $692. What was the total amount of her sales for the week?

The total amount of the salesperson's sales for the week is $6,200

Total earnings= $692

Total hours worked = 40 hours

Earnings per hour = $8

Total hourly earnings = Total hours worked × Earnings per hour

= 40 hours × $8

= $320

Commission earnings = Total earnings - Total hourly earnings

= $692 - $320

= $372

Total amount of her sales for the week = x

6% of x = $372

0.06 × x = 372

0.06x = 372

x = 372 / 0.06

x = $6,200

Therefore, her total amount of her sales for the week is $6,200

Solve the equation using the Properties of Equality.
3- m/6= 12 solve for m

Answers

Answer:

[tex]m=-54[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

We have the equation [tex]3-\frac{m}{6}=12[/tex] and we want to solve for m using the Properties of Equality.

Steps:

1) Subtraction Property of Equality (subtract 3 from both sides):

[tex](3-\frac{m}{6})-3=(12)-3[/tex]

[tex]-\frac{m}{6}=9[/tex]

2) Multiplication Property of Equality (multiply both sides by -6):

[tex]-6(\frac{m}{-6})=-6(9)[/tex]

[tex]m=-54[/tex]

Therefore, our final answer is [tex]m=-54[/tex]

the image if the point (5,-1) under a reflection in the y-axis is

Answers

(-5,-1) is the answer

the reflected image of the point (5,-1) under the y-axis is (-5, -1).

What are coordinates?

A pair of numbers called coordinates are used to locate a point or a form in a two-dimensional plane. The x-coordinate and the y-coordinate are two numbers that define a point's location on a 2D plane.

Given a coordinate (5, -1), find the image of the coordinate under a reflection in the y-axis.

Since

When a point is reflected in the x-axis, the sign of its ordinate changes. When a point is reflected in the y-axis, the sign of its abscissa changes. When a point is reflected in the origin, the sign of its ordinate and abscissa both change.

thus, Coordinates of image = (-5, -1)

Therefore, the image of the point (5,-1) under a reflection in the y-axis is (-5, -1).

Jan and Julie went for a bike ride. They started their ride at 09:30 and finished at 15:15. • They stopped for a drink for 20 minutes • They took 45 minute for lunch • They rested for 10 minutes. How long were they riding on their bikes for? (excluding stops)

Answers

Given:

Jan and Julie started their ride at 09:30 and finished at 15:15.

Stopped for a drink = 20 minutes

Lunch = 45 minute

Rest = 10 minutes

To find:

Time they are riding on their bikes (excluding stops).

Solution:

Jan and Julie started their ride at 09:30 and finished at 15:15.

So, total time of ride including stops is 5 hours 45 minutes or we can say 345 minutes calculated as

[tex]30+60+60+60+60+60+15=345\text{ minutes}[/tex]

We need subtract Drink, lunch and rest time from the total time to get the Time they are riding on their bikes (excluding stops) is

[tex]345-20-45-10=270 \text{ minutes}[/tex]

Therefore, the total time they are riding on their bikes (excluding stops) is 270 minutes.
